Q: Is 33,432,679 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 33,432,679 is not a prime number.

Why is 33,432,679 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 33432679 can be evenly divided by 1 7 29 157 203 1,049 1,099 4,553 7,343 30,421 31,871 164,693 212,947 1,152,851 4,776,097 and 33,432,679, with no remainder.

Since 33,432,679 cannot be divided by just 1 and 33,432,679, it is not a prime number.
